What Is Local Seo?
Local SEO is the process of optimizing a website to rank higher in local search results. This involves techniques that help businesses appear in searches conducted by users in a specific location. Common local SEO practices include optimizing Google My Business, adding local keywords, and obtaining local citations.

Citation Management
Citations are online mentions of your business name, address, and phone number (NAP). Consistent citations across various platforms enhance your local search rankings. Local SEO tools assist in:
- Finding existing citations
- Correcting inconsistent NAP information
- Building new citations on relevant directories
Maintaining accurate citations helps search engines verify your business information, boosting your local search visibility.
Google My Business Optimization
Google My Business (GMB) is a critical component of local SEO. Local SEO tools optimize your GMB profile by:
- Ensuring your business information is complete and accurate
- Managing customer reviews
- Tracking GMB performance metrics
An optimized GMB profile increases your chances of appearing in the local pack and maps, making it easier for customers to find and contact you.
Local Link Building
Local link building involves acquiring backlinks from local websites, which helps improve your local search rankings. Local SEO tools aid in:
- Identifying local link opportunities
- Analyzing the quality of local backlinks
- Tracking the progress of your link-building efforts
Building high-quality local links establishes your business as an authority in your area, enhancing your credibility and search visibility.
